firmware/src/packages/fff
Johannes Kimmel 8e3db2b314 fff-dhcp: increase dns cachesize
The default cachesize for dnsmasq is 150 entries, which results in a
poor cache hit rate.

Raise the default to 1024 to provide better cache hit rates on all
devices while still keeping memory usage in check.

Further increase the cachesize to 8192 entries for systems with enough
ram (currently more than 64MB).

The memory usage will increase roughly 100B per entry.

The size was chosen empirically. Higher values don't seem to increase
cache hit rate a lot.

Signed-off-by: Johannes Kimmel <fff@bareminimum.eu>
2022-01-03 11:50:23 +01:00
..
alfred-json treewide: use SPDX license identifiers 2021-03-06 18:53:26 +01:00
fff fff: create proper package variants instead of copying file 2021-02-09 22:54:05 +01:00
fff-alfred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-alfred-monitoring-proxy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-babeld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-batman-adv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-boardname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-config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-dhcp fff-dhcp: increase dns cachesize 2022-01-03 11:50:23 +01:00
fff-fastd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-firewall fff-firewall: Flush all installed tables. 2021-11-10 13:42:14 +01:00
fff-hoods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-hoodutils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-layer3 fff-layer3-config: add rules for router_ip 2021-12-01 00:06:08 +01:00
fff-layer3-config fff-layer3-config: add rules for router_ip 2021-12-01 00:06:08 +01:00
fff-macnock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-mqtt fff-mqtt: Remove unnecessary mosquitto server 2021-12-20 18:51:50 +01:00
fff-mqtt-monitoring packages/fff: Add package fff-mqtt-monitoring 2021-11-10 13:42:14 +01:00
fff-network Drop support for devices with less than 8/64 MB flash/memory 2021-11-28 15:09:42 +01:00
fff-node packages/fff: drop redundant PKG_BUILD_DIR 2021-01-27 20:22:02 +01:00
fff-nodewatcher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-ra packages/fff: drop redundant PKG_BUILD_DIR 2021-01-27 20:22:02 +01:00
fff-random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-simple-tc packages/fff: drop redundant PKG_BUILD_DIR 2021-01-27 20:22:02 +01:00
fff-support Retain old compat_version for sysupgrade compatibility 2021-11-28 15:09:42 +01:00
fff-sysupgrade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-timeserver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-uradvd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-vpn-select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-web-hood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-web-mqtt packages/fff: Add package fff-web-mqtt 2021-11-10 13:42:14 +01:00
fff-web-ui Unify package URL in fff-packages 2021-11-10 13:42:03 +01:00
fff-wireguard fff-wireguard: Add missing include for get_mac_label 2021-09-02 17:03:20 +02:00
fff-wireless Drop support for devices with less than 8/64 MB flash/memory 2021-11-28 15:09:42 +01:00